... it shouldn't look like it does!

I have medium brown hair. Total middle of the road natural hair colour that's a bit brown and a bit muddy dishwater.

So, from previous experience I know if I get a medium brown hair colour it can go a bit too dark on my hair and leave me looking washed out.

So i have put on a nice n easy pale brown colour. Not golden, not warm or chesnut, just plain brown.

ScumbagCollegeDropout · 10/05/2013 00:13

No don't dye it again for at least a month.

Off the shelves dyes have bleach in them. Bleaching twice in a couple days will not be good at all for your hair.

Sorry!

I hear Head & Shoulders is a great colour stripper. Maybe wash your hair a lot with that.

Nagoo · 10/05/2013 13:37

I think that accidental colour is lovely :)

You could put a semi permanent nice and easy ash colour on it as a toner if you wanted, but permanent dye probably a bit much straight away.
